Description

Situated in a lovely rural setting the property has undergone a comprehensive scheme of refurbishment over the last three years by the current owners, improvements included re wiring, new windows, floorings, decoration, refitted kitchen and two shower rooms, new smart electric heating system utilising the power generated by the 6KW Wind Turbine. The generously proportioned property boasts large living rooms with high ceilings, library, kitchen/diner with conservatory off, utility, W.C., four generous bedrooms and two shower rooms. Outside the property has a large workshop, garage, store room, wood store, summerhouse, kitchen garden and landscaped grounds with established hedging and trees, total plot size of 2 acres. Agents Notes - The property is fitted with a six kilowatt wind turbine producing around 13 megawatts per year covering the majority of the heating costs for the property.
